Output 84b1dee9519bcbbdfab31e5bb8f72cb461d0ee0ecbef2dbc7b53bee68c7dc6d5:63

value
510388
script pubkey
OP_0 OP_PUSHBYTES_20 70b7efa64069e9eead025bd5637635d3d9bc7643
address
bc1qwzm7lfjqd857atgzt02kxa3460vmcajrn6yu7d
transaction
84b1dee9519bcbbdfab31e5bb8f72cb461d0ee0ecbef2dbc7b53bee68c7dc6d5
spent
true